Misfeed at Paper Feed Cabinet Paper Take-Up and Transport Section J02, J03, J04, J05,
J1 (PF-120) Troubleshooting Procedures
• Paper is not taken up at all.
Step
1
Paper meets product specifications.
2
Paper is curled, wavy, or damp.
3
Edge Guides and Trailing Edge Stop
are at correct position to accommo-
date paper.
4
Paper Take-Up Roll is dirty, scratchy,
deformed, or worn.
5
Mylar is dirty, scratchy, or deformed.
6
Separator Fingers are dirty or
deformed.
7
Paper guide plate is dirty or
deformed.
8
Paper Take-Up Solenoid (SL11)
operation check:
The voltage across PJ3A-1A on Con-
trol Board (PF-120: PWB-A) and
GND changes from DC0 V to DC24 V
when the Start key is pressed.
9
Paper Take-Up Sensor (PC12) oper-
ation check:
The voltage across PJ3A-2 on Con-
trol Board (PF-120: PWB-A) and
GND is DC 5 V when the sensor is
unblocked and DC 0 V when the sen-
sor is blocked.
• Paper is at a stop near the vertical transport section or Synchronizing Roller.
Step
1
Vertical Transport Roller/Rolls are
dirty, deformed, or worn.
2
Paper is curled, wavy, or damp.
3
Synchronizing Roller Sensor (PC1)
operation check:
The voltage across PJ6A-3 on Mas-
ter Board (copier: PWB-A) and GND
is DC5 V when the sensor is blocked
and DC0 V when the sensor is
unblocked.
